Place Stanislas is the heart of the city of Nancy. It's here you'll find the City Hall, the Opera House, the Musée des Beaux-Arts and many other important buildings.
The Musée des Beaux-Arts de Nancy brings together works by many artists including Monet, Delacroix, Picasso, Caravaggio, Perugino...

First, start your little getaway by heading to Place Stanislas. A symbol of the city, it was built during the 1750s and is now a UNESCO World Heritage Site. If UNESCO included it in its listing, you're sure to find it charming too!
On the square, you can admire the Opera House, the City Hall and other landmark buildings. Place Stanislas isn't the only square in Nancy, but it's certainly the one to visit if you're short on time.

Next, time for some culture! Among the most important museums in Nancy are the Musée des Beaux-Arts de Nancy and the Musée de l'École de Nancy! The Tictactrip team has a real soft spot for the latter. There you can see Art Nouveau like you've never seen it before. The museum is housed in the former home of a great collector, so it's small but not to be missed under any circumstances!
